Can the Food We Eat Affect Your Heart Rate? Experiment Results and Insights

In recent years, there has been growing interest in the impact of diet on overall health, including its influence on heart rate. Heart rate is a critical indicator of cardiovascular health, and understanding how food can affect it is crucial for maintaining a healthy lifestyle. This article explores the results of a comprehensive experiment designed to determine whether the food we consume can indeed impact our heart rate.

The experiment involved a diverse group of participants, each with varying dietary habits. Over a period of four weeks, participants were asked to maintain their usual diets while wearing heart rate monitors. Throughout the experiment, their heart rates were recorded at various times, including before and after meals.

The first phase of the experiment focused on the immediate impact of food on heart rate. Researchers found that consuming foods high in saturated fats, such as fried foods and red meat, resulted in a significant increase in heart rate. Conversely, foods rich in omega-3 fatty acids, such as fish and flaxseeds, led to a decrease in heart rate. These findings suggest that the composition of our diet plays a significant role in regulating heart rate.

The second phase of the experiment examined the long-term effects of dietary patterns on heart rate. Participants were divided into two groups: one group followed a heart-healthy diet, which included plenty of fruits, vegetables, whole grains, and lean proteins, while the other group continued with their usual diet. After four weeks, the heart-healthy group showed a notable reduction in their resting heart rates compared to the control group.

Moreover, the experiment also looked at the impact of caffeine and sugar on heart rate. Researchers discovered that consuming caffeine, especially in large quantities, can lead to an increase in heart rate. Similarly, high sugar intake was associated with a higher heart rate. These findings highlight the importance of limiting the consumption of caffeine and sugar to maintain a healthy heart rate.

In conclusion, the experiment revealed that the food we eat can indeed affect our heart rate. By making informed dietary choices, such as consuming a balanced diet rich in omega-3 fatty acids and whole foods, we can potentially improve our cardiovascular health and reduce the risk of heart-related diseases. Furthermore, minimizing the intake of caffeine and sugar can also contribute to a healthier heart rate.
